A Portuguese surgeon, merchant and missionary of the Society of Jesus in Japan. He is credited for establishing the first "western" hospital in Japan.

Biography

Luis de Almeida was a surgeon and Jesuit missionary in Japan in the Sengoku period. He was also involved with trade. According to Danny Chaplin's "Sengoku Jidai":
The jewel in the Jesuit crown was the port town of Nagasaki, which had practically been founded by the Society of Jesus. In the year 1567, the year before Nobunaga entered Kyoto, a Jesuit by the name of Luis de Almeida chanced upon a neglected fishing village and noted its potential as a deep water harbour.
